Do unlimited rotating proxies support automatic regional ip switching?

PYPROXY PYPROXY · Oct 26, 2025

Infinite rotation proxies have become an essential tool for users who need to manage large-scale data scraping, bypass geo-restrictions, or protect their anonymity online. The core function of such proxies is to provide a dynamic set of IP addresses that rotate automatically, but the key question remains: Does this automatic IP rotation system allow seamless switching between regional IPs?

In this article, we will analyze whether infinite rotation proxies support automatic switching of regional IPs. We will discuss the capabilities and limitations of such systems, factors affecting regional switching, and the benefits this feature brings to users across various industries.

Understanding Infinite Rotation Proxies

Infinite rotation proxies, also known as rotating proxies or proxy pools, are a set of multiple IP addresses managed by a proxy provider. These proxies automatically switch between various IP addresses at regular intervals or after each request, making it extremely difficult for target servers to block or track the user’s activity.

For users involved in activities like web scraping, SEO analysis, or data mining, rotating proxies provide an effective solution to avoid detection, IP bans, and geographical restrictions. These proxies can be sourced from various regions globally, but how well the system can switch between different regions automatically is a key concern.

How Does Automatic Region IP Switching Work?

Automatic region IP switching involves rotating the IP addresses not only at random intervals but also ensuring that each IP belongs to a different geographic location. In theory, infinite rotation proxies can be designed to support automatic region switching, but this is highly dependent on the proxy provider and the technical architecture of their system.

1. Proxy Pools with Regional IP Segmentation

Some providers segment their proxy pools into regional categories. For instance, they may have a set of IP addresses dedicated specifically to the U.S., Europe, Asia, and other regions. When a request is made, the system can dynamically choose an IP address from the desired region. This allows users to target specific countries for localization, bypass restrictions, or access region-locked content automatically.

2. Automated IP Rotation Protocols

Many advanced proxy systems use automated protocols to rotate IPs at specific intervals. These protocols can be set up to prioritize geographic location. For example, when a user requests an IP from a specific region, the proxy provider will ensure the next IP address belongs to that region, thus ensuring automatic switching between region-specific IPs.

Factors Affecting Regional IP Switching

While the technology to support automatic region switching exists, several factors determine how effectively this feature works.

1. Proxy Pool Size

The larger the proxy pool, the more likely it is that a system can automatically switch between regions without running out of available IPs. Smaller proxy pools may have a limited number of regional IPs, making region-specific IP rotation less reliable.

2. Provider Infrastructure

Some providers have better infrastructure than others, offering faster, more dynamic regional switching. Factors like server speed, the frequency of IP rotation, and the distribution of IP addresses across various regions directly impact the quality of regional switching.

3. Customization Options

The ability to customize the IP rotation rules plays a crucial role. Some providers allow users to set up automatic region switching based on time intervals, traffic load, or even specific requests. Others may offer only basic rotation without considering geographic location.

Benefits of Automatic Region IP Switching

1. Geo-targeting

Automatic region IP switching is a great asset for businesses that need to perform region-specific tasks, such as targeting ads to a specific country, conducting regional SEO analysis, or accessing localized content.

2. Increased Privacy and Anonymity

For individuals concerned with privacy, using regional IP switching adds another layer of anonymity. By rotating IPs across various countries, users can avoid detection and minimize the risk of being tracked by third-party websites or hackers.

3. Overcoming Geo-blocking

Many websites and platforms restrict access based on geographic location. With automatic region IP switching, users can bypass such restrictions effortlessly, gaining access to content that is otherwise unavailable in their region.

4. Scalability for Web Scraping and Data Mining

For large-scale data collection operations, rotating IPs from different regions ensures that web scraping activities can scale without hitting rate limits or facing geographical IP bans. This makes it easier to collect diverse datasets while ensuring compliance with regional access restrictions.

Limitations of Automatic Region IP Switching

Despite the benefits, there are certain limitations to consider when using automatic regional IP switching with infinite rotation proxies.

1. Reliability of Region-Specific IPs

In some cases, automatic regional IP switching may not work as smoothly as anticipated. Proxy providers may not have a comprehensive set of IPs in every region, leading to a situation where users are assigned random IPs, rather than the expected region-specific ones.

2. Performance Delays

Switching between different regions could lead to slight performance delays, especially if the proxy provider doesn’t have optimized infrastructure. Users may notice slower speeds or intermittent connection issues if the region switching process isn’t smooth.

3. Additional Costs

Accessing region-specific proxies might come with an extra cost. Some providers charge a premium for proxies from particular regions, which could increase the overall cost of using rotating proxies.

In conclusion, infinite rotation proxies can indeed support automatic region IP switching, but the efficiency and reliability of this feature depend heavily on the proxy provider’s infrastructure, the size of their proxy pool, and the level of customization offered. While large-scale providers with well-structured pools offer robust region-switching features, smaller or less efficient providers may not be able to deliver seamless region IP rotation.

For businesses or individuals requiring geo-specific tasks or a higher level of anonymity, opting for a reliable proxy provider that supports automatic region switching will be crucial. However, users should remain mindful of potential limitations, such as reliability, performance delays, and additional costs associated with regional proxies.

By understanding these factors, users can make informed decisions about using infinite rotation proxies to meet their specific needs effectively.
